CAPE stands for Caribbean Advanced Proficiency Examination. It is considered a Post-Secondary Education qualification as it is normally written when students are in the sixth form years of secondary schools.
There is no qualification requirement to pursure CAPE examinations but some subject areas strongly recommend that the CSEC level studies in the subject area be convered before pursuing CAPE studies.
There is no requirement to attempt Unit 1 before Unit 2. Both Units can be attempted simultaneously or Unit 2 can be attempted before Unit 1. Only the Mathemathics and the Chemistry syllabuses recommend the Pure Mathematics Unit 1 and Chemistry Unit 1 respectively be attempted before the corresponding Unit 2.
Students can sit for as many Units as they wish at a single sitting. CXC encourages candidates who intend to pursue university studies or wish to compete for National Scholarships to do at least eight Units; three 2-Unit subjects in their area of focus and Communication Studies and Caribbean Studies.
Grades I - V are considered acceptable Grades for further study.
An Associate Degree is a post-secondary Level 4 qualification which comprises core, general and elective courses. While the associate degrees may serve as exit qualifications, they are really designed to articulate with Bachelor's Degrees in several fields. Each CXC Associate Degree is valued at 80 credits.
In order to qualify for the Associate Degree, a candidate must have obtained acceptable grades (I - V) in at least seven CAPE Units withing a five year period.

Typically, persons in a full-time study will complete the Associate Degree in two years, however, the degrees are flexible and allow up to five years for completion.
Caribbean Studies and Communication Studies are compulsory in all nine Associate Degree since educators int he region felt that these were necessary for all Caribbean students at this level. In addition, each Degree has one or more compulsory Unit/s.
The CXC Associate Degree offers numerous possibilities. Candidates will be able to obtain credits and/or exemptions at some universities, gain employment and be able to gain promotion in their work place. Ultimately, CXC would like to see candidate entering university benefiting from a two-plus-two arrangement. This is still to be negotiated with universities.
